MySQL
Use this skill to make safe, measurable MySQL/InnoDB changes.

Workflow
- Define workload and constraints (read/write mix, latency target, data volume, MySQL version, hosting platform).
- Read only the relevant reference files linked in each section below.
- Propose the smallest change that can solve the problem, including trade-offs.
- Validate with evidence (
EXPLAIN,EXPLAIN ANALYZE, lock/connection metrics, and production-safe rollout steps). - For production changes, include rollback and post-deploy verification.
Schema Design
- Prefer narrow, monotonic PKs (
BIGINT UNSIGNED AUTO_INCREMENT) for write-heavy OLTP tables. - Avoid random UUID values as clustered PKs; if external IDs are required, keep UUID in a secondary unique column.
- Always
utf8mb4/utf8mb4_0900_ai_ci. PreferNOT NULL,DATETIMEoverTIMESTAMP. - Lookup tables over
ENUM. Normalize to 3NF; denormalize only for measured hot paths.

Indexing
- Composite order: equality first, then range/sort (leftmost prefix rule).
- Range predicates stop index usage for subsequent columns.
- Secondary indexes include PK implicitly. Prefix indexes for long strings.
- Audit via
performance_schema— drop indexes withcount_read = 0.
